The panel responsible for the selection of the 30 winners is composed of Chin Chih Yang (Artist and Chief Curator of 123Soho), Heidi Jain (Photographer and former instructor at Mercer County and Brookdale Community College), and Younghee Choi Martin The art of Younghee Choi Martin is a distinctive mix of classical and modern, employing a semi-abstract style to express tragic and heroic themes. Affirming that ³painting is silent poetry,² she draws inspiration from works of classical literature such as the Oresteia of Aeschylus and Virgil's Aeneid. Educated at the Rhode Island School of Design and in Rome, and the recipient of numerous honors, she has had 18 solo shows and over 50 group exhibitions in New York and throughout the United States, as well as in France, Italy, Japan, and Korea.

Chin Chih Yang

When Perfidy Meets Virtue:

An installation and performance by artist Chin Chih Yang

Date: September 18-21 (Tuesday-Thursday) 9-5pm and October 9-10 (Tuesday-Wednesday) 11-6pm

Venues:

Das Hammarskjold Plaza ( 1st Avenue and 47th Street ) and Ralph Bunche Park , ( Unite Nations, at 42 nd Street and First Ave. ), New York City

Performance and installation will travel to other cities in the US .

Content:

In this installation and performance entitled " When Perfidy Meets Virtue ", the artist Chin Chih Yang, uses flags and ceremony as vehicles for the emergence of the modern Taiwanese nation, and the opposition to this process by China and other members of the United Nation whose self-interests serve as an obstacle to this process. 

 

"123PollutionSolution" Cans and Video Installation Project

35,000 cans and 10,000 MetroCards plus Video installation in Union Square/ North Park, NYC - May 20, 2007 and Fort Lee Community Center, NJ - July 21, 2007

Unfortunately, pollution has become an integral part of our lives. We ourselves are the only ones who may be able to come up with a collective solution to this dilemma. Chin Chih Yang's art attempts to help us think "outside the box" in our efforts to come up with a plan to save ourselves and our planet.

The approximately 35,000 cans for this 123PollutionSolution project were collected during the last 2 years by the approximately 500 students and parents from the Tzu Chi Academic in Cedar Grove, New Jersey. I would like to express my gratitude and appreciation to them for their efforts.
